Musical Moments Spotlight: Amante & Walker

Acoustic duo brings their talents to Savatt Park Friday evening.

 

Joanne Amante and Frank Walker will bring their acoustical music to Russ Savatt Park , Main Street Friday night.

The duo, with Walker on bass and Amante as the vocalist, will present original songs as well as some familiar favorites.

Amante, a Kings Park resident, began singing as a child. Her father, a blues/jazz guitarist, led folk groups in church, where Amante sang in the choir throughout her teens and twenties. Walker and Amante met at an open mike night. Walker, of Hicksville, also showed his love for music at an early age, and became an adept at piano, guitar, bass and drums during high school.

 Musical Moments in Kings Park, a series of free outdoor concerts, are held (weather permitting) each Friday through August 31. Please bring seating.
